Senior Digital Product Manager,

3 months ago


Old Toronto, Ontario, Canada Scotiabank Full time

Requisition ID: 198630
Join a purpose driven winning team, committed to results, in an inclusive and high-performing culture.

We are seeking a Senior Product Manager to develop, plan, and implement Scotiabank's Digital Banking strategic priorities Small Business clients. This role will develop a compelling product vision, strategy, roadmap, and define key business objectives (OKRs).

You will leverage your deep understanding of business & technology strategies, customer feedback, analytics, market trends, and will continually prioritize the direction and desired outcomes for the product portfolio. You will partner with technology & design teams, control functions, and business lines to deliver the optimal customer experience.

Is this role right for you?

  • Creating measurable, repeatable value for internal and external customers.
  • Building scalable software solutions across platforms and devices.
  • Lead problem discovery to understand customer needs, current challenges and work closely with design and engineering partners to come up with solutions.
  • Creating, communicating, and gaining buy-in for your product vision and feature roadmap.
  • Collaborating and building strong relationships with stakeholders and cross-functional teams, including engineering, analytics, marketing, UX/UI, business partners and other product teams to deliver high-quality products.
  • Driving short and long-term product strategies, and goals, and scaling new capabilities across platforms.
  • Continuously interpreting customer needs and business pain points to determine the biggest problems to solve.
  • Making data-informed decisions & conducting hypothesis-driven product development.
  • Understanding how the Bank's risk appetite and risk culture should be considered in day-to-day activities and decisions.

Do you have the skills that will enable you to succeed in this role?

  • 5+ years of experience in a role building customer-facing digital products
  • You have experience in web, mobile, or microservice development
  • You have led a technology product or a digital journey end to end, from inception to delivery
  • Experience working in or with cross functional teams such as Engineering, Design, and Accessibility teams
  • You are a strong problem solver and have a bias for action
  • You have a curious and experimental mindset to drive innovation amidst uncertainty
  • You have excellent organizational and analytical skills with strong attention to detail
  • You have strong verbal and written communication skills with the ability to engage and influence stakeholders at different levels in the organizations
